Effects of vanadate on water and electrolyte transport in rat jejunum.

J J Hajjar, S Zakko, T K Tomicic.   

Abstract

The effect of vanadate (orthovanadate, VO4-) on water and ion transport was studied in rat jejunum. Water transport was tested by single-pass perfusion in vivo and ion fluxes by the Ussing-chamber technique in vitro. The results suggest that vanadate has two actions on ion and water transport: At low concentrations (10(-4) M) it causes Cl-, Na+ and water secretion by stimulation of adenylate cyclase; At higher concentrations (10(-3) and 10(-2) M) it decreases net absorption of Na+ and Cl- by inhibition of (Na+ + K+)-ATPase.
